What Rewards Have We Unlocked So Far in Sonic Rumble?
- 3,000 Rings from early milestones
- Movie Sonic rewards for mid-tier progress
- 7,000 Rings as the challenge built momentum
- 200 Star Coins/Gems before the latest unlock
- Now, 200 Skill Stars at 70 million
How Close Is Sonic Rumble to the Shadow Sticker?
With 70 million down and only 30 million to go, this final stretch depends on collective effort. Logging in daily, racing hard, and stacking those Shadow Coins could tip the scales quickly—perfect for players chasing that complete Shadow the Hedgehog theme in their loadouts.
